Quote:
Originally Posted by
Androzani84
So we?re at the point where Eiji becomes a Dinosaur Greeed. Which despite what you might think, wasn?t set in stone from the start, as producer Naomi Takebe had cold feet about implementing the idea. There was also the fact the identity of the dinosaur Greeed was also constantly changing, from a new character, to Hina (which would?ve been the explanation for her super strength) to Date (after his planned death and resurrection), before they went with Maki.
Got to wonder how the idea of Hina being the dinosaur Greeed would've worked, considering how her big bro Shingo is totally human. It's much more bad*ss that Hina's super strength is just a Hina thing though. A supernatural explanation would've ruined that.

Quote:
Originally Posted by
Kamen Rider Die
KAMEN RIDER OOO EPISODE 48 - ?MEDALS FOR TOMORROW, UNDERWEAR, AND ARMS TO REACH OUT WITH?
It?s a very sweet and sad ending for Ankh, which is what needed to happen for this finale to work. It?d be hard to argue that this isn?t a season
about
Ankh, first and foremost; even Eiji?s story here is about how Ankh has helped him change and grow. Letting Ankh sacrifice the life that he was after to help his friend, because it only
became
that life through his friendship, that?s as poignant and poetic an ending as you can get, even before we start talking about hands reaching out and all that. Ankh?
In his own profound words, Ankh's hand isn't the one Eiji needs to reach out to anymore. Ankh has already been saved by Eiji through his sincere acts of kindness, that allowed Ankh to finally realize what he was missing all along, a void that the Medals alone couldn't fill. It's not even Ankh suddenly becoming selfless or anything, he wants to repay the favor to Eiji, since it's Eiji and he can no longer deny that he cares about him. Ankh sacrifices himself in the name of his desire, one that actually makes him complete.
There's some behind the scenes stuff here as well, with Kobayashi apparently wanting an ending with Eiji dying instead, but that got an executive veto, like her scrapped ending for Ryuki with all Riders dying. Makes me wonder if she might've had a similar idea for Den-O's Imagins when they were fading away, but they're way too popular for an ending like that as they're needed for future crossovers. For OOO though, I think the ending we got works good enough and the image of the cracked Taka Medal has become a symbol of Eiji's and Ankh's tragic unbreakable connection, like the bench for Kenzaki and Hajime.
